Step 1
In a medium mixing bowl combine beaten egg, bread crumbs, cilantro, onion, 1/4 cup of the chutney, 2 teaspoons of the ginger, cumin, salt, and pepper. Add ground beef; mix well. Shape meat mixture into four 3/4-inch-thick patties.
Step 2
Grill patties on the rack of an uncovered grill directly over medium coals for 14 to 18 minutes or until done (160 degree F), turning once halfway through. Top with cheese slices. Grill, uncovered, about 2 minutes more or until cheese begins to melt.
Step 3
In a small bowl stir together the remaining chutney and remaining ginger. Spread chutney mixture onto buns. Serve patties on buns. Serve with sliced onion, sliced tomato, and lettuce leaves, if desired. Makes 4 servings.
